Understanding the In-Office HydraFacial Treatment

First performed in 2004, an original HydraFacial treatment deeply cleanses and nourishes the skin in three main steps:

  1. Cleansing/Peeling: The aesthetician uses a spinning tip that simultaneously cleanses, exfoliates, and vacuum extracts impurities from the pores.
  2. Acid Peel: Glycolic and salicylic acid solutions are applied to loosen debris in the follicles and brighten the skin.
  3. Hydration: Hyaluronic acid, antioxidants, and peptides are infused to plump and nourish the skin.

The HydraFacial leaves skin clean, exfoliated, hydrated, and glowing. It is safe for most skin types but does require an in-office visit. Now at-home hydrafacial devices give a similar multistep treatment minus the hassle.

Complementary Skincare Ingredients

Certain complementary skincare ingredients can enhance and prolong the results of at-home hydrafacial treatments:

Vitamin C

Vitamin C serums used after your hydrafacial help brighten skin and protect from environmental damage.

Retinol

Applying a retinol serum or cream at night expedites cell turnover to reveal fresh new skin.

Hyaluronic Acid

Hyaluronic acid boosts hydration and plumps skin to fill in fine lines and wrinkles.

Ceramides

Ceramide creams repair the skin barrier to boost moisture retention and supple skin.

Peptides

Peptides stimulate collagen production to firm and smooth skin over time.

Targeting Specific Skin Concerns

In addition to general rejuvenation, at-home hydrafacial devices can target specific skincare concerns by customizing serums:

Acne

Use salicylic acid or tea tree oil serums to penetrate pores, kill bacteria, and prevent breakouts.

Hyperpigmentation

Serums with vitamin C, kojic acid, and licorice root extracts will lighten dark spots.

Dullness

Alpha hydroxy acid serums with lactic acid or glycolic acid will brighten and resurface dull skin.

Fine Lines

Antioxidant and peptide serums will soften the look of fine lines and wrinkles.

Dehydration

Hyaluronic acid and glycerin serums attract moisture to parch dry skin.

Safety Tips for At-Home HydraFacial Treatments

When using an at-home hydradermabrasion device, keep these safety guidelines in mind:

  • Always follow manufacturer instructions.
  • Start on the lowest settings and gradually increase as tolerated.
  • Avoid putting the device nozzle directly against moles or lesions.
  • Do not use if you have open wounds, rashes, or infections.
  • Never share your device with others to prevent bacteria transfer.
  • Stop immediately if you experience any pain or irritation.
  • Discuss use with doctor if you have a condition that affects skin sensitivity.

With proper use, at-home hydrafacial devices safely provide professional quality skincare without leaving your bathroom. Be sure to patch test serums and introduce new ingredients gradually to ensure your skin tolerates them well.
